Pumpkin and Mushroom Risotto – Italian recipes by GialloZafferano
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Pumpkin and mushroom risotto is a first course with autumn flavors. Unlike the classic pumpkin risotto, per this recipe, the sweetness of the pumpkin is enhanced by slow oven cooking, preserving its creaminess and perfectly pairing with the earthy note of pleurotus mushrooms. The final touch of fresh chives is not just an aesthetic choice but adds a slight freshness to the dish. Pumpkin and mushroom risotto is ideal for those looking for a warm, satisfying first course, allowing you to bring a colorful and delicious dish to the table without overcomplicating your life per the kitchen.

To prepare the pumpkin and mushroom risotto, first cut the pumpkin and remove the seeds and internal fibers 1. Divide it into 4 pieces and place each piece a sheet of aluminum foil, season with oil 2salt, and pepper 3.

Add, to each piece, the unpeeled garlic and sage 4. Close the aluminum foil sheets 5 and cook per a preheated static oven at 450°F for 1 hour. Meanwhile, interruzione the cleaned pleurotus mushrooms with your hands 6.

Sopra a pan, pour a drizzle of oil, add the unpeeled garlic and sage 7and sauté over low heat. Add the mushrooms 8raise the flame, and brown them for a few minutes. Season with salt and pepper 9.

Scoop out the pumpkin pulp with a spoon 10 and transfer it to a bowl. Add a little tazza 11 and blend with an immersion blender 12 until a smooth puree is obtained. Set aside.

Sopra a pot, heat the oil, add the rice 13and toast for a few minutes. Pour per tazza 14season with salt 15and continue cooking, adding a ladle of tazza each time the previous one is absorbed by the rice.

Once halfway through cooking, add the pumpkin puree 16stir 17and finale cooking. At the end, add the oil 18.

Season with salt and pepper 19. Add the mushrooms 20reserving some for plating, and the chives 21. Stir for a few minutes.

Plate, place the mushrooms 22 the surface of the rice, and finale with the chives 23. Your pumpkin and mushroom risotto is ready to be enjoyed 24.
